How to Request an Apostolic Blessing from Pope Leo XIV: A Step-by-Step Guide
Pope Leo XIV already grants apostolic blessings to the faithful around the world, a deeply rooted tradition in the Catholic Church that can now be easily processed, both in person and online, through the Vatican's Apostolic Almoner's Office

These blessings, printed on elegant parchments, are a tangible sign of the spiritual closeness of the Successor of Peter and are granted on the occasion of key moments in Christian life: baptisms, confirmations, marriages, ordinations, religious professions, significant anniversaries, or particularly significant birthdays.
Where and how to request a blessing?
The Vatican’s Apostolic Almoner’s Office—the only body authorized to issue these official blessings—offers two ways to obtain the document:
1. In person at the Vatican
Faithful located in Rome can go directly to the offices of the Almoner’s Office, located within Vatican City. Access is through the Porta di Sant’Anna, next to the colonnade in St. Peter’s Square.
Opening Hours:
- Mondays, Wednesdays, Fridays, and Saturdays: 8:30 a.m. to 1:30 p.m.
- Tuesdays and Thursdays: 8:30 a.m. to 5:30 p.m. (local time)
2. Online
For those far from Rome, the digital procedure is also accessible through the official website of the Apostolic Almoner’s Office (the only authorized portal).
Steps to follow:
- Choose the reason for the blessing (sacrament or anniversary).
- Select the desired parchment model.
- Fill in the required information (names, dates, location of the celebration).
- Register the applicant and choose the delivery method (local pickup or DHL Express).
- Make the corresponding donation using a VISA or MasterCard.
The system also allows you to create a personal account to facilitate future requests. Once the process is complete, the applicant will receive a confirmation email with the estimated delivery date.
How much does it cost and how long does it take?
- Estimated time:
-
- Pickup at the office: approximately 25 days.
- International shipping: up to 30 days.
- Approximate cost of the parchment: between 20 and 30 euros, depending on the model.
- Shipping costs:
-
- Italy: from 15 euros
- Europe: approximately 25 euros
- Africa: up to 40 euros
It is important to note that the proceeds, after deducting production and shipping costs, are entirely donated to the Pope’s charitable works through this pontifical office.
What are valid occasions?
The Almonry establishes certain criteria for granting the apostolic blessing. It is granted on the occasion of:
- Sacraments: Baptism, First Communion, Confirmation, Marriage, Ordination, Religious Profession.
- Significant anniversaries: Silver or golden wedding anniversaries, birthdays marking decades (50, 75, 100 years, etc.).
- In these latter cases, a “declaration of suitability” may be required, certifying that the recipients are practicing Catholics.
Requests by regular mail, fax, or email are not accepted. Any unofficial channel will be automatically rejected.
A gesture of faith and charity
Beyond the parchment and protocol, requesting an apostolic blessing is a way of uniting oneself spiritually with the Pope and supporting the works of mercy he promotes on behalf of the entire Church. A gesture that, on important dates, can become a true sign of shared faith and ecclesial communion.
